The Value of Top Quality Products in Furniture
Why are quality materials vital for resilient furniture?- Investing in top notch products makes sure that your furniture will certainly stand up to day-to-day deterioration, making it last for years. Quality products additionally contribute to the general aesthetic appeals of the item, giving it an extravagant and innovative look. Choosing long lasting products reduces the demand for constant repair services or replacements, saving you time and money in the lengthy run.
- Wood: Strong wood, such as oak or mahogany, is a popular option for its stamina and natural beauty. Metal: Steel or light weight aluminum are generally used in contemporary furniture for their toughness and sleek appearance. Upholstery: Fabrics like leather or microfiber supply comfort and add a touch of beauty to furniture pieces. Synthetic materials: High-grade synthetic products like polypropylene or polycarbonate are commonly used in exterior furniture as a result of their resistance to weather conditions.
- Wood: Solid timber furniture can last for generations if properly taken care of, as it can be refinished and repaired over time. Metal: Metal structures are very resilient but might require periodic upkeep to stop rusting or corrosion. Upholstery: The top quality of furniture material plays a considerable function in establishing its life-span. Seek materials with high abrasion resistance and very easy maintenance. Synthetic products: Outdoor furniture made from artificial products are developed to endure severe climate condition and UV exposure.
Factors to Take Into Consideration When Choosing Furniture Materials
Durability:- Look for products that can stand up to regular usage without losing their structural honesty or aesthetic appeal. Consider the intended purpose of the furniture and pick products as necessary. For instance, a dining table should be able to handle spills and scratches.
- Evaluate the degree of maintenance required for each and every material. Some may need constant cleansing or polishing, while others are a lot more low-maintenance. Consider your way of life and the quantity of time you want to buy maintaining your furniture.
- Choose materials that line up with your personal design and complement the overall style of your space. Consider the color, texture, and surface of the products to guarantee they enhance the visual appeal of your furniture.
- With raising recognition of sustainability, it is very important to take into consideration the environmental impact of different materials. Look for furniture made from responsibly sourced or recycled products to minimize your carbon footprint.
- Set a budget for your furniture acquisition and consider the expense of different products within that budget. Keep in mind that buying top notch products may require a greater in advance price however can conserve you money in the future by avoiding frequent replacements.
FAQs regarding Picking Furniture Materials
Q: What is one of the most durable product for furniture? A: Solid timber, such as oak or teak, is taken into consideration one of one of the most long lasting materials for furniture because of its toughness and ability to stand up to wear and tear.
Q: Are synthetic products appropriate for indoor furniture? A: Yes, artificial materials like polypropylene or polycarbonate can be utilized for indoor furniture, specifically in areas susceptible to wetness or high traffic.
Q: Exactly how can I figure out the quality of upholstery textile? A: Search for upholstery fabric with a high Martindale rub count, indicating its abrasion resistance. In addition, look for firmly woven fabrics and take into consideration stain-resistant options.
Q: Can metal furniture be used outdoors? A: Yes, particular metals like light weight aluminum or stainless steel appropriate for exterior use as they are immune to corrosion and corrosion.
Q: What is the best material for outdoor furniture? A: Teak wood and cast light weight aluminum are preferred options for outside furniture as a result of their longevity and resistance to weather conditions.
Q: Can I mix different materials in my furniture pieces? A: Yes, mixing materials can produce interesting aesthetic contrasts and include deepness to your furniture design. Just make sure that the products balance well together.
